Arno Raunig was born in 1957 in Klagenfurt, Austria and sang with the Vienna
Boys' Choir from 1966-72, 4 years as a soloist. He studied oratorio and
lieder singing at the Bruckner conservatory in Linz with
Kurt Equiluz. Later, he made a special voice training with Ruthilde
Bösch and Erika Mechera in Vienna. Several opera rôles
were written especially for him.
His main repertoire is the baroque opera, but he sang also in romantic and
